About This Trial

This study is a randomized control trial, and the purpose of this study is to determine the "Effects of Facilitated Positional Release Technique ( FPRT) Vs Manual Myofascial Release Technique in Female Patients with Piriformis Syndrome.

Eligibility Criteria
Inclusion Criteria: * • 25-50 years Only females Diagnosed piriformis syndrome Pain from 2 months Exclusion Criteria: * Lumbar Radiculopathy Fracture trauma to lumbar spine surgery/ total hip replacement hip OA
